PETTY v. OY


93 A.D.2d 791 (1983)

George S. Petty, Appellant, v. Myllykoski Oy et al., Respondents

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, First Department.

April 28, 1983


Shortly after personal service was effected upon defendant Myllykoski Oy, all three defendants moved to dismiss the complaint alleging lack of jurisdiction over defendant Myllykoski Oy and failure to join an indispensable party (Myllykoski Oy) as to the other two defendants. Special Term erred in not holding the motion in abeyance and granting plaintiff's request for further discovery.
